ActivityManager.KillBackgroundProcesses(String)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
让系统立即终止与给定包关联的所有后台进程。
[Android.Runtime.Register("killBackgroundProcesses", "(Ljava/lang/String;)V", "GetKillBackgroundProcesses_Ljava_lang_String_Handler")]
[Android.Runtime.RequiresPermission("android.permission.KILL_BACKGROUND_PROCESSES")]
public virtual void KillBackgroundProcesses (string? packageName);
[<Android.Runtime.Register("killBackgroundProcesses", "(Ljava/lang/String;)V", "GetKillBackgroundProcesses_Ljava_lang_String_Handler")>]
[<Android.Runtime.RequiresPermission("android.permission.KILL_BACKGROUND_PROCESSES")>]
abstract member KillBackgroundProcesses : string -> unit
override this.KillBackgroundProcesses : string -> unit
参数
- packageName
- String
要终止其进程的包的名称。
- 属性
注解
让系统立即终止与给定包关联的所有后台进程。 这与内核终止这些进程以回收内存的过程相同;系统将根据需要在将来重启这些进程。
<p class=“note”>On devices that run Android 14 or higher, third party applications can only use this API to kill own process. </p>
适用于 . 的 android.app.ActivityManager.killBackgroundProcesses(java.lang.String)
Java 文档
本页的某些部分是根据 Android 开放源代码项目创建和共享的工作进行的修改,并根据 Creative Commons 2.5 属性许可证中所述的术语使用。